Honey aficionados and aspiring apiarists will have a unique opportunity this year to realize their honey-slinging, beekeeping dreams. On Thursday, January 8, the West Virginia Southeastern Beekeepers Association is launching a free beekeeping class aimed at providing hands-on training to those looking to start a hive or two in their own backyards.
